I have a pair of 175XXX Serial Beolab 5. One of them is stuttering and eventually not playing at all when using the Digital In. When i bought them (used about 4 months ago) everything worked fine. With Powerlink they work as well. Any idea what might cause this?
what is the source of your spdif signal?
sometimes when this signal is not powerful enough it will not be recognized by the beolab 5 input, but will get buffered and sent through to the next beolab 5. Resulting in silence or intermittent sound in the receiving speaker, and normal operation of the linked speaker.
if your spdif source is a toslink to spdif converter, i have good experience with the converter made by 'oehlbach'.

These early production models do not utilize the sync socket. If you connect a cable and the signal only get´s sent to one of the speakers, the other one will turn itself off. They started using the Sync socket from serial number 17772145.

What you describe still suggests the SPDIF signal is not strong enough to find its way into both BL5's. One of them recognizes it and plays, the other one does not. I have seen this in two different pairs of BL5 now.
SPDIF through RCA cable is a quality technique. But it needs quality cables and a quality source. In many instances it just works with mediocre material, but the BL5 SPDIF digital input interface seems very fussy about the impedance of the signal. Hifi berry or PC outputs for SPDIF are often just the 5V TTL signal attenuated to +/-0,5V with a resistor and capacitor. Not powerful enough.
Use a quality source, again I know the oehlbach TOSLINK to SPDIF converter works well, your PC and Pi probably have toslink. It delivers a powerful buffered SPDIF signal. And use quality, not too long, 75 ohm impedance cables.
